How much does an energy storage system cost?

Energy storage system costs stay above $300/kWh for a turnkey four-hour duration system. In 2022, rising raw material and component prices led to the first increase in energy storage system costs since BNEF started its ESS cost survey in 2017. Costs are expected to remain high in 2023 before dropping in 2024.

Comparing battery energy storage arbitrage strategies in ERCOT

Ancillary Service clearing prices are declining, relative to Energy prices. Additionally, more batteries are becoming commercially operational every month - meaning more competition in those markets. As a result of these changes, more battery energy storage capacity is available to perform Energy arbitrage.

How Can Energy Storage Better Participate in China''s Ancillary Services

How Regulations for Energy Storage Participation in Ancillary Services Markets are Designed in Foreign Countries. The United States was the first country to incorporate energy storage into its ancillary services network at a large scale. Numerous commercialized energy storage projects currently provide ancillary services to the US power grid.

ERCOT: H1 2024 battery energy storage revenue round-up

In the past twelve months, battery energy storage rated power in ERCOT has more than doubled. From the end of June 2023 to the end of June 2024, the total installed rated power of battery energy storage in ERCOT rose from roughly 2.4 GW to 5.3 GW. This represents a 120% growth in twelve months.

Energy Storage As A Service Market Report Scope

The global energy storage as a service market size was valued at USD 1.2 billion in 2020 and is expected to expand at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.7% from 2021 to 2028. The market is expected to be driven by the increasing demand for power management services and cost-effective battery backup power in case of a power outage.
